Think about the amount of coffee you are going to make. Traditionally, a cup of coffee is six ounces, while a measuring cup is eight. The best ratio is about 2 tbsp. of coffee to 6 ounces water. If you use a measuring cup, you’ll end up with watery coffee.

Drip brew coffee with cold water only. Never use warm or hot water in drip style coffee pots. In these types of machines, the coffee is brewed as the water gets heated. Hot water for your coffee will likely scald coffee grounds. This leads to poor tasting coffee and can be a safety issue as well.

For hearty flavor, try using a French press for your next coffee. Paper filters in your typical drip-style machine will soak up all the oils in your coffee that are packed with flavor. A French press doesn’t have filters, but it has a plunger which forces the beans to the very bottom. Therefore, the oils stay in the brew, creating a fuller flavor.
